[clang][DebugInfo][test] Move debug-info tests from CodeGenCXX to DebugInfo directory (#154538)
This patch works towards consolidating all Clang debug-info into the
`clang/test/DebugInfo` directory
(https://discourse.llvm.org/t/clang-test-location-of-clang-debug-info-tests/87958).

Here we move only the `clang/test/CodeGenCXX` tests. I created a `CXX`
subdirectory for now because many of the tests I checked actually did
seem C++-specific. There is probably overlap between the `Generic` and
`CXX` subdirectory, but I haven't gone through and audited them all.

The list of files i came up with is:
1. searched for anything with `*debug-info*` in the filename
2. searched for occurrences of `debug-info-kind` in the tests

There's a couple of tests in `clang/test/CodeGenCXX` that still set
`-debug-info-kind`. They probably don't need to do that, but I'm not
changing that as part of this PR.

// FIXME: llvm.org/pr51221, the APSInt leaks
// RUN: export LSAN_OPTIONS=detect_leaks=0
// RUN: %clang_cc1 %s -triple x86_64-windows-msvc -gcodeview -debug-info-kind=limited -emit-llvm -o - | FileCheck %s
// RUN: %clang_cc1 %s -triple x86_64-linux-gnu -debug-info-kind=limited -emit-llvm -o - | FileCheck %s
// RUN: %clang_cc1 %s -triple powerpc64-ibm-aix-xcoff -debug-info-kind=limited -emit-llvm -o - | FileCheck %s
enum class uns : __uint128_t { unsval = __uint128_t(1) << 64 };
uns t1() { return uns::unsval; }
enum class sig : __int128 { sigval = -(__int128(1) << 64) };
sig t2() { return sig::sigval; }
// CHECK-LABEL: !DICompositeType(tag: DW_TAG_enumeration_type, name: "uns", {{.*}})
// CHECK: !DIEnumerator(name: "unsval", value: 18446744073709551616, isUnsigned: true)
// CHECK-LABEL: !DICompositeType(tag: DW_TAG_enumeration_type, name: "sig", {{.*}})
// CHECK: !DIEnumerator(name: "sigval", value: -18446744073709551616)
